How Our Team Handles Bedroom Water Removal
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ure that your home is restored to its original condition. We start by assessing the damage, identifying the source of the water, and containing the affected area to prevent further damage.
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
Our technicians will assess the damage and identify the source of the water. We’ll then contain the affected area using specialized equipment to prevent further damage and ensure your safety.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using our advanced equipment, we’ll extract the standing water from your home, reducing the risk of further damage and reducing the drying time.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ry your home, including dehumidifiers and air movers.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and ensuring your home is safe to inhabit.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Cleaning
Once your home is dry, our team will sanitize and clean the affected area, removing any remaining moisture and debris.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Repair
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that your home is safe and secure. We’ll also make any necessary repairs to get your home back to normal.

Warning Signs You Need Bedroom Water Removal
Ignoring water damage in your bedroom can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Here are some warning signs you shouldn’t ignore: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ors in your bedroom can show the presence of mold and mildew. If you notice a musty smell that persists even after cleaning, it’s time to call our team.
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ls
Water stains on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of a leaky pipe or roof damage. Don’t ignore these stains, as they can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ice your flooring is damaged, it’s essential to address the issue immediately to prevent further damage.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ice your paint or wallpaper is peeling, it’s time to call our team to assess the damage.
Mold Growth in the Attic or Basement
Mold growth in your attic or basement can be a sign of water damage. If you notice mold growth, it’s essential to address the issue immediately to prevent health hazards.
Increased Humidity in the Home
Increased humidity in your home can lead to mold growth and water damage. If you notice your home is feeling damp or humid, it’s time to call our team to assess the issue.

Bedroom Water Removal Cost in Scribner, NE
The cost of Bedroom Water Removal in Scribner, NE varies dep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a free estimate after assessing the damage.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of Bedroom Water Removal: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Mold remediation |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area and type of mold |
| Sanitizing and cleaning |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and type of cleaning required |
| Repair and re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area and type of repair required |
